Telangana Minister Warns Over Road Work Delays
The Roads and Buildings Minister in Telangana, Komatireddy Venkat Reddy, visited Mothkur municipality to check on road works.
He was unhappy to see that the work was not finished and warned that delays would not be tolerated.
He said that the Mothkur-Rajannagudem road must be completed in two months.
The minister also promised to help with payments once the work is done.
He told officials to plan for widening another road to make traffic better.
There have been many accidents because the roads are not finished.
Important people like the district collector and a senior engineer were also there during the inspection.
